To be fair to Butcher, he has really only had one bad game. He did look out of touch at Lord's, but lets not go off the deep end.

My only concern with Butcher is that lately he seems not able to convert 40's and 50's into century's.

Still, given that this time last week, the general view in the media seemed to be for Hussain to go (either now or by the end of the summer), it's a real turn around to see the pressure being put on Butcher!
